ArrayHashSearch.

Suchtgut für Arrays und Hashes in Perl
Jetzt downloaden

ArrayHashSearch.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Perl Artistic License
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Serge Tsafak
  • Website des Verlags:
  • http://search.cpan.org/~tsafserge/

ArrayHashSearch. Stichworte


ArrayHashSearch. Beschreibung

Dienstprogramm für Arrays und Hashes in Perl ArrayHashSearch ist ein Perl-Modul, das Routinen zur Durchsuchung des Inhalts von n-dimensionalen Arrays und / oder Hashes für bestimmte Werte bereitstellt. Diese Routinen sind nützlich für Personen, die oft die Existenz bestimmter Werte in komplexen Datenstrukturen testen, die von anderen Routinen zurückgegeben werden. Derzeit gibt es derzeit Keine solchen eingebauten Funktionen zum Suchen von Arrays / Hashes, man kann Zeit mit diesem Modul sparen.Synopsis verwenden ArrayHashSearch; mein $ dummyarrayref = ; mein $ dummyarrayref2 = ; if (array_contain ($ dummyarrayref, 7)) {drucken "Wert 7 existiert im Array!"; } if (array_deeply_contain ($ dummyarrayref2,7)) {drucken "Wert 7 existiert im Array!"; } Ein komplexeres Beispiel: Verwenden Sie streng; Warnungen verwenden; Verwenden Sie ArrayHashSearch; mein $ dummyarray1 = ; mein $ dummyarray2 = ; mein $ dummyarray3 = ; mein $ dummyHash1 = {1 => 'a', 2 => 'B', 3 => 'c'}; mein $ dummyHash2 = {1 => $ dummyHash1,2 => 'd', 3 => 'e'}; mein $ dummyHash3 = {1 => 'f', 2 => 'g', 3 => $ dummyHash2}; meine $ dummystructure1 = ; meine $ dummystructure2 = {1 => 'h', 2 => $ dummystruktur1,3 => 'i'}; drucken "Array Bingo! \ n", wenn array_deeply_contain ($ dummyarray3,5); drucken "Hash Bingo! \ n", wenn hash_deeply_contain ($ dummyHash3, 'a'); drucken "Array / Hash Bingo! \ N", wenn tiede_contain ($ dummystructure1,5); drucken "Hash / Array Bingo! \ n", wenn tiede_contain ($ dummystructure2, 'a'); Anforderungen: · Perl.


ArrayHashSearch. Zugehörige Software